Parashat Ekev: The Final Tests
This week’s parasha is Ekev which means heel. Rabbi Zilberstein writes in his sefer Vaveh HaAmudim, we must internalize the fact that we are the generation of the ikvetah d’Mashicha, which means the heel of Mashiach. We are the final generation before Mashiach will come and our Rabbis have warned us that our generation will be subject to tests that no other generation has seen.
One of these tests is the cellphone. Of course the main test is making sure that everything about the phone is kosher, but even after we are able to overcome that great hurdle and conquer that test, there are still other tests after that, namely the addiction of people having to be with their phones all the time. This causes them to not be able to fully focus, even when they are involved in the holiest of services to Hashem. Interrupting prayers or Torah learning to check the phone is a major distraction and insult to HaKadosh Baruch Hu.
The tests in life are hard, but the rewards are great.
